氧自由基与脑胶质瘤瘤周水肿关系的实验研究  被引量:3

Relationship Between Oxygen Free Radical and Peritumor Edema in Glioma

摘  要:目的:探讨自由基和脑胶质瘤瘤周水肿的关系。方法:体外培养大鼠C6脑胶质瘤细胞株,采用立体定向技术将细胞株接种在右侧尾状核,建立大鼠脑胶质瘤模型,共60只,术后5天将荷瘤大鼠随机分为3组(EDA高剂量组,EDA低剂量组和对照组),每组各20只,每组10只用来测定荷瘤大鼠瘤周脑组织含水量、SOD活性及MDA含量,剩余10只用来观察荷瘤大鼠生存时间。结果:EDA干预组荷瘤大鼠瘤周脑组织含水量下降,SOD活性增高,MDA含量下降,以EDA高剂量组更为显著。各组荷瘤大鼠瘤周脑组织含水量与SOD活性呈负相关,而与MDA含量呈正相关。且EDA组荷瘤大鼠生存时间延长。结论:由基参与大鼠脑胶质瘤瘤周水肿的形成,自由基清除剂能够减轻大鼠脑胶质瘤瘤周脑组织水肿。Objective:To investigate the relationship between oxygen free radical and peritumor edema in glioma.Methods:The rat C6 glioma cells were cultivated in vitro.The suspention of C6 glioma cells was stereotaxically injected into right caudate to establish rat C6 glioma model.After surgery,all rat glioma models were randomly classified into 3 groups(edaravone-trteated group in high dose,edaravone-trteated group in low dose and control group).Each group had twenty rats.Ten rats from each group were used to determine the moisture content in peritumor brain tissues,SOD activity and the content of MDA.The other 10 rats were used to detect the survival time after surgery.Results:The decreased moisture and MDA contents in peritumor brain tissues and increased SOD activity were found in edaravone-treated group,especially in high dose.The survival time was longer in edaravone-treated group than that of control group.Conclusion:Oxygen free radical is involved in the formation of peritumor edema in glioma,and the free radical scavenger may reduce the peritumor edema in glioma.

关 键 词:脑胶质瘤 瘤周水肿 依达拉奉
